Hey Priya,

Handing off on-call with one heads-up: the legacy ORM refactor in Quillbase is half-done. The old mapper in `coredata/` still backs billing queries, so don't delete anything there yet. New folks: read the migration doc in the Quillbase wiki before touching model code. Tests pass but are flaky on the session pool. If anything breaks overnight, escalate to the data platform rotation here.

escalation mailbox, bafog-fafog: ulador@paliqlabs.internal

## Authentication

Build agents in the Tarnfield fleet sign their artifact manifests with short-lived tokens, and token validation is sensitive to clock skew. Agents drifting more than 90 seconds from the Chronomast time service will fail signing with `AUTH_SKEW`, which blocks the release train. Before cutting a release, run the skew audit and resync any flagged agents. The audit tool itself authenticates to Chronomast with a dedicated service credential that the release manager holds. The current key is listed below for that purpose.

API key for yahig-tadup: kto7_ubizbYm

Subject: DR Drill Friday — Read-Replica Lag Alarm

Hi all,

This Friday we're running a disaster-recovery drill on the Fernvale reporting database. We'll artificially induce replica lag past the 90-second alarm threshold and walk through the failover steps together. New folks: your job is to follow the runbook, not memorize it. Expect pages from the staging alert channel only. To access the drill's restricted console, you'll enter the recovery passphrase provided below.

unlock words, hahip-baduf: holwyn-istath-julvan

# Dedup client for MergeWell. Matches customer records across the Brinport
# and Solvane imports using fuzzy name + postal scoring. Support team: run
# this only after the nightly sync finishes, or you'll merge half-written
# rows. Merges are reversible for 30 days via the undo queue. Do not tweak
# the threshold without asking the data team first. The client authenticates
# against the internal MergeWell gateway with the key below.

gateway credential: vxb4-QTMv